I never can tell if the point of these articles is to question whether Belichick is an illusion and the loss of [fill in the blank with a name] will pull the curtain away and expose him as a fraud or rather the point is to compliment Belichick as the one necessary piece to the organization's management puzzle. This article seems like the latter case.
I still believe Belichick has a system at both the field and management level that allows things to go on business as usual when someone moves on to another team. The team's outlook supposedly was bleak after Weis and Crennel left in 2005, but somehow the Pats moved on and subsequently Mangenius, McDaniels and potentially Pioli are deemed worthy of high offices in the NFL. Acknowledging Weis, Crennel and Mangenius did not light the world on fire without Belichick, at what point do observers start concluding the thing those three were missing, specifically Belichick, explains their success with the Patriots.
